CHILL OUT MARTY! You have to keep your wits about you, just in case Holly needs you! Take a few deep breaths & relax. Holly is probably just resting. Its very common for mares in late gestation to lay down (even if they don't usually). They are carrying a lot of weight & they do get tired. Gosh, mine will even lay flat out & sleep like that for weeks before foaling. (and this is something they never do any other time).

Just keep an eye on her....I'll bet she'll just rest a bit & then get back up & return to her "normal" routine. Keep us posted!

I would however get them used to seeing me every night late so if their were and impending labor,, they would not FREAK when I suddenly appeared way out of schedule. So around 11 I would go out, check butts and bags and go back in.

Just watch her bag, but dont be fooled by no milk! If the bag is full watch her like a hawk. And I believe she is a maiden right? So everything is out the window,, you have your camera and does she have a halter monitor?? You will be fine.

Get some of the milk test strips too if you do not already have them. I rely on them a lot.

Remember to take notes on her unusual things so the next time she has a baby you will know. Mine started taking hour long naps about 3 times a night a month before the babies came. Only one took about 1/2 hour naps. I have kept files on all of my mares.
biggrin.gif


They even have wild dreams and start making noises, which can really shock you if you are dosing off while watch the web cam.
